What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1910.212(a)(1): Types of guarding. One or more methods of machine guarding shall be provided to protect the operator and other employees in the machine area from hazards such as those created by point of operation, ingoing nip points, rotating parts, flying chips and sparks. Examples of guarding methods are-barrier guards, two-hand tripping devices,electronic safety devices, etc.   a) On or about August  19, 2019  the Thropp Rubber Mill did not have machine guarding such as but not limited to area barrier guards, etc., to protect the operator from hazards such as placing the material such as rubber and/or polymer into the point of operation exposing the employees to the ingoing nip points and the rotating rollers.   b) On or about August 19, 2019, the Hardinge Lathe did not have machine guarding such as an area barrier guard, etc., to protect the operator from hazards such as polishing parts against the 1200 rpm rotating point of operation of the rotating shaft exposing employees to being struck by and/or caught in the rotating part.
